MY UFC VALUE TARGET (CASH&GPP):

Jake Collier (+110) (DK 7800) (FD $14) vs. Andrei Arlovski (-138) (DK 8400) (FD $17).

Oh wow… who would’ve thought that the ageless wonder Old Man Arlovski would still have a number by his name at the age of 43. That in and of itself is an incredible feat and adds to the illustrious career of Arlovski. Let’s face facts though, he is not what he used to be. He gasses out rather quickly, he doesn’t hit quite as hard and his chin is um suspect. All that being said… Collier is worse. Collier wins just enough against guys like Sherman (more on him later) and Villante to barely keep himself in the UFC but a loss against Arlovski would be more than enough justification to finally cut Collier for good. Collier has all of the same weaknesses as Arlovski without any of the excuses. Arlovski truly has nothing left to prove but if anyone is making a run at the top in their 40s it would be Arlovski. I only see this fight going past three rounds so I would recommend taking the fight going the distance at (-188). Either side of this fight is pretty risky but if you are looking at it for DFS purposes, go for the Pitbull Arlovski.

MY UFC DFS PICK: Andrei Arlovski (-138) (DK 8400) (FD $17). UNANIMOUS DECISION

MY UFC LOCKED-IN TARGET (CASH):

Alexandr Romanov (-2500) (DK 9600) (FD $23) vs. Chase Sherman (+1100) (DK 6600) (FD $8).

(This fight was booked last week and got moved to this week late in the card due to a minor health issue from Sherman. Everything below still applies)

This is Chase Sherman’s last fight in the UFC and this matchup is his walking paper. Sherman has dropped his last three fights, only beating Ike Villanueva in the UFC his losses came against Old Man Arlovski, Parker Porter and Jake Collier. Not exactly a who’s who of the heavyweight division. This fight however is against one of the biggest heavyweight prospects in the UFC with a perfect 15-0-0 record including a win against fellow heavyweight prospect Juan Espino. To put this as simply as possible, Sherman does not stand a chance. Romanov has excellent power, a surprisingly strong ground game for a heavyweight and crisp fight IQ. Not to mention, Sherman is coming into this fight on short notice after Tanner Boser dropped off this weekend’s card. Statistically, they’re not even close, Romanov easily edges out Sherman in all major stat categories. The only thing going for Sherman is his 77% takedown defence rate but he has not fought someone with the takedown abilities of Romanov. This will be another pit stop on Romanov’s rise to the top of the heavyweight division.

MY UFC DFS PICK: Alexandr Romanov (-2500) (DK 9600) (FD $23) FIRST-ROUND KO (possible FIRST-ROUND SUBMISSION).

MY UFC TOP SCORING TARGET (GPP):

Tatsuro Taira (-250) (DK 9200) (FD $22) vs. Carlos Candelario (+200) (DK 7000) (FD $9).

Both of these fighters will be making their UFC debuts on tonight’s card and interestingly enough Candelario is coming into the UFC on a split decision loss in his most recent fight (which also happened to be on the Dana White’s Contender Series). His opponent is one of the most highly touted prospects coming out of Japan, Tatsuro Taira. Taira has a perfect 10-0-0 record with seven of those wins coming by first-round submission, so it should come as no surprise where Taira’s skill set lies. He’s got a lethal arsenal of front chokes and back chokes and although Candelario will be his biggest test to date, he should pass it with flying colours.

MY UFC DFS PICK: Tatsuro Taira (-250) (DK 9200) (FD $22) FIRST-ROUND SUBMISSION.
